Telenor Satellite now Space Norway

Following its acquisition by Space Norway Group in January, Telenor Satellite will now be recognised by its new name, Space Norway. Space Norway provides critical satellite services to governments, commercial maritime, land-based industries, and major broadcasters. Schilbred Fasmer named Telenor CEO

Telenor Group’s Board of Directors has appointed Benedicte Schilbred Fasmer as new President & CEO. Space Norway wraps purchase of Telenor Satellite

Telenor Satellite has announced that its acquisition by Space Norway has been ratified following approval from the Norwegian Parliament. The transaction was closed with the formal signing of the agreement on January 4th. Telenor Pakistan sold to PTCL

Telenor Group has announced the sale of its Pakistan telco operations to Pakistan Telecommunications Company (PTCL), which is part of technology and investment group e&. Telenor sells satellite business

Telenor, which has been looking to dispose of its satellite division for some years, has finally announced a buyer in the shape of Norwegian government-owned business, Space Norway.
